Understanding Trauma-Informed Care in the UK
Trauma-informed practices are rapidly gaining awareness within the UK's social care sector. This evolving model shifts the attention from simply asking "What's wrong?" to "What happened to you?" . It acknowledges the significant impact of negative experiences, such as violence, on an individual’s responses and overall well-being . Delivering trauma-informed assistance involves creating safe environments, building positive relationships, and empowering individuals by fostering a sense of choice and protection . The goal isn’t to resolve trauma directly, but to understand how past experiences might be shaping current behaviours and to provide compassionate help that avoids re-traumatisation .
Trauma Therapy UK: Research-Supported Approaches
In the UK , treating PTSD necessitates a considered approach based on scientifically-backed therapies. Frequently-used interventions encompass trauma-focused talk therapy, such as EMDR , CPT , and narrative exposure therapy . Moreover, qualified mental therapists may utilize stabilization techniques and medication where appropriate , always emphasizing individual treatment. Availability to these services is gradually improving through the public health system and charitable sector, though challenges remain in ensuring equitable availability for all sufferers.

A Growth of Trauma-Sensitive Approaches in the UK
Across multiple sectors in the UK, there’s been a growing shift towards implementing trauma-informed principles. Originally stemming from fields like social work, this perspective is now permeating areas such as schools, the judicial process, and patient services. This expanding recognition of the consequences of adverse childhood experiences on long-term well-being has led to fresh efforts to create nurturing environments and offer more helpful care for vulnerable individuals.
